2013-04-08 63 views
0

我正在使用滑块来显示一些WordPress帖子。当我打开页面时,会在这段时间内挂起几秒钟(时间变化),布局中断(例如滑块中的所有文章变得可见而不是第一篇文章),但一旦页面加载完毕,每一件事情都会恢复正常。页面加载时布局中断

我认为这是因为jQuery代码加载较晚。我能做些什么吗?

我currenly使用这样的:

jQuery(document).ready(function() { 
    jQuery("#foo1").carouFredSel(); 
}); 

此外,我怎么能检查与萤火虫是什么原因造成的? (哪些资源需要花费时间来加载),因为它发生得太快,我没有时间在Firebug上看到。

回答

1

你可以隐藏它并使其显示:无。直到它加载然后显示它

<script>  
jQuery(document).ready(function() { 
jQuery("#foo1").carouFredSel(); 
jQuery("#foo1").show(); 
}); 
</script> 
<div id="foo1" style="display:none"></div> 
1

Firebug有一个网络面板,可以让你查看浏览器发出和接收到的请求/响应。

enter image description here

我假设它是最有可能不是jQuery的。您访问该网站几次后,它应该在您的缓存中。